WESTFORD, Mass. - April 15, 2025 - PRLog -- The global Population Health Management (PHM) market is on an accelerated growth trajectory, driven by a rising focus on value-based care, the incre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, and advancements in digital healthcare technologies. As healthcare systems shift from reactive treatment to proactive care models, PHM is becoming essential for improving patient outcomes, managing costs, and driving system-wide efficiency.

Population Health Management refers to the strategic collection and analysis of patient health data to improve clinical and financial outcomes across a defined population. PHM platforms support risk stratification, care coordination, patient engagement, and performance measurement—making them critical tools for modern healthcare delivery.

Market Size and Forecast

- Market Value in 2024: USD 32.8 billion
- Projected Value by 2032: USD 98.27 billion
- CAGR (2025–2032): 14.7%

This growth is fueled by the convergence of healthcare policy reform, digital transformation, and the growing need to manage aging populations with complex care needs.

Key Market Drivers

- Chronic Disease Burden: Growing prevalence of diabetes, cardiovascular conditions, and respiratory diseases demand coordinated, long-term care strategies.
- Policy Shifts: Governments and payers are pushing for value-based care models, accelerating PHM adoption.
- Data Explosion in Healthcare: The rise of EHRs, wearable devices, and remote monitoring is creating massive volumes of usable health data.
- Artificial Intelligence and Analytics: Predictive modeling and machine learning are making PHM more accurate and actionable.

Challenges and Restraints

- Data Privacy and Compliance: Managing sensitive health data across platforms requires strict adherence to regulatory frameworks like HIPAA and GDPR.
- Integration Complexities: Legacy systems and data silos hinder seamless adoption.
- High Initial Investment: Cost barriers can be significant for smaller providers or developing markets.
